Some pivotal certifications you might consider for a Quality Assurance Tester role include the following.

ISTQB Foundation Level Certified Tester

The ISTQB Foundation Level Certified Tester provides a standardized framework for understanding software testing principles and practices, which enhances alignment within development teams. This certification validates a tester's foundational knowledge, reducing onboarding times and potentially lowering training costs. Employers seek certified testers as it signals a commitment to the field and an understanding of critical methodologies and terminologies. Possession of this certification may improve job prospects and career growth, as organizations often prefer candidates with a recognized qualification.

ISTQB Advanced Level Test Analyst

The ISTQB Advanced Level Test Analyst certification equips quality assurance testers with deep theoretical and practical knowledge, enhancing their ability to identify and resolve complex software issues. This certification ensures testers have advanced skills in test design techniques, allowing them to effectively validate functionality. Qualified Test Analysts contribute to improved test coverage, leading to higher quality software releases and reduced defect leakage to production. Companies investing in such testers often experience increased efficiency in the testing process, resulting in cost savings and accelerated development timelines.

ISTQB Advanced Level Test Manager

Completing the ISTQB Advanced Level Test Manager certification equips Quality Assurance Testers with advanced skills in test management, enhancing their ability to plan, monitor, and control testing processes effectively. This certification provides a structured understanding of risk-based testing, helping testers prioritize testing efforts to cover critical areas, often resulting in more efficient and effective testing strategies. With this advanced knowledge, test managers can better align testing objectives with organizational goals, improving communication and collaboration with stakeholders during the development lifecycle. The certification facilitates the development of effective test teams by supplying best practices for staff management and team dynamics, contributing to overall project success.

Certified Software Quality Analyst (CSQA)

CSQA certification provides a standardized understanding of quality assurance principles, which enhances a tester's ability to identify and address software defects effectively. This certification offers methodologies and best practices, leading testers to adopt industry-proven techniques that improve software quality. CSQA credentials also elevate a tester's credibility in a competitive job market, often resulting in better job prospects and career advancement opportunities. Organizations benefit from testers with CSQA certification, as they bring improved resource efficiency and a structured approach to quality assurance processes.

Certified Software Test Engineer (CSTE)

CSTE certification enhances a tester's understanding of software quality principles, leading to improved testing practices. This credential validates a tester's proficiency in identifying defects, which ensures the reliability and performance of software products. A certified tester usually receives structured training, resulting in a more systematic approach to quality assurance that aligns with industry standards. Employers often trust certified professionals more, reducing the risk of defects in software releases.

Certified Agile Tester (CAT)

The Certified Agile Tester (CAT) qualification provides a deep understanding of Agile methodologies, enhancing a QA tester's ability to adapt to iterative development cycles. With the CAT certification, testers gain practical skills in Agile testing environments, leading to improved communication and collaboration with cross-functional teams. The certification equips testers with tools to better assess and address quality issues early in the development process, ultimately reducing defects. Organizations benefit as CAT-certified testers contribute to faster delivery times and higher-quality software products.

Selenium WebDriver Certification

Holding a Selenium WebDriver Certification often signals a solid understanding of automated testing frameworks, which can lead to increased job prospects for a Quality Assurance Tester. The certification can validate one's skill in effectively identifying and resolving software issues, enhancing product reliability. Industry standards frequently evolve, and a formal credential tends to show that a tester is up-to-date with the latest practices. Employers may prefer certified testers as they likely reduce onboarding time and training costs due to proven competencies.

Six Sigma Green Belt Certification

The Six Sigma Green Belt Certification equips Quality Assurance Testers with methodologies to improve process efficiency, directly impacting product quality. Mastery of statistical analysis and data collection techniques enhances defect detection capabilities, leading to decreased error rates. Training in Six Sigma empowers testers with problem-solving skills, enabling them to identify root causes and implement effective solutions. Enhanced competency in process improvement contributes to cost reduction and increased customer satisfaction, valuable metrics for organizations.

HP LoadRunner Certification

HP LoadRunner Certification equips Quality Assurance Testers with the skills to effectively use one of the industry's leading performance testing tools, which enhances their ability to identify and diagnose bottlenecks in applications. Proficiency in LoadRunner is often a requirement for companies focusing on robust performance testing, making certified testers more competitive in the job market. The certification validates a tester's capability to execute tests that simulate real-world loads on software, ensuring reliability and scalability. Certified individuals are usually more adept at optimizing performance test strategies, which can directly impact the quality and performance of software products.

Certified Manager of Software Quality (CMSQ)

Obtaining a Certified Manager of Software Quality (CMSQ) credential enhances a Quality Assurance Tester's credibility, indicating proficiency in evaluating and improving software processes. CMSQ-certified testers tend to implement more rigorous quality standards, leading to enhanced software reliability and fewer defects. The certification often results in higher organizational trust, potentially accelerating career advancement opportunities within the tech industry. Employers may prioritize hires with CMSQ credentials, perceiving them as having a deeper understanding of quality management and strategic testing approaches.
